The F\u00fcrstin-Ann-Mari-von-Bismarck-Schule is located in Aum\u00fchle, Schleswig-Holstein. It was inaugurated on December 10, 1952. The school is named after Ann-Mari von Bismarck. She lived from 1907 to 1999.

This primary school has 175 students. Eighteen teachers work here. The curriculum includes eleven subjects. Two prevention officers support the school. The F\u00fcrstin-Ann-Mari-von-Bismarck-Schule actively participates in various projects. It is a Zukunftsschule, a school focused on the future. This program supports innovative teaching. It provides connections to external partners. The school also partners with Internet-ABC. This program promotes responsible internet use. F\u00fcrstin-Ann-Mari-von-Bismarck-Schule participates in the DigitalPakt Schule. This national initiative invests in digital education. The goal is to build a modern digital infrastructure. The school organizes events like the \”Weihnachten im Schuhkarton\” Christmas drive. They host book readings. They organize sports projects with local clubs. Students participate in projects. They create Christmas decorations. They visit butterfly gardens. They explore the forest.

The F\u00fcrstin-Ann-Mari-von-Bismarck-Schule emphasizes community. Parents and volunteers contribute significantly. They support events like the children’s festival. The school promotes sustainable practices. Students learn about energy. They participate in the \”Fridays for Future\” movement.

The school integrates arts. Students work with local artists. They create Christmas greetings. They design colorful mosaics. The F\u00fcrstin-Ann-Mari-von-Bismarck-Schule also focuses on safety. They teach road safety. They provide safety vests to first-graders.

The F\u00fcrstin-Ann-Mari-von-Bismarck-Schule celebrates achievements. In 2015, its girls’ team won the district hall soccer tournament. The school participates in sports events.
